Mr. Eric Liégeon draws the attention of the Minister to the Minister of Labor, Health, Solidarity and Families, responsible for health and access to care, on the subject of the neurological disease cluster headache (AVF). This disease, often chronic, is refractory to treatment. Patients who suffer from it live with intense and disabling pain. AVF's nickname is "suicide disease." According to a study dated February 24, 2020, relayed by several scientific media, this disease would be classified as the most intense pain measured in humans, based on the McGill pain scale. Despite the fact that it affects 120,000 people in France, this disease is not recognized in its chronic form. To date, neither the departmental centers for disabled people (MDPH), nor the National Insurance Fund illness (CNAM) do not recognize AVF as a disabling illness systematically giving entitlement to care for a long-term illness (ALD), or to the disabled adult allowance (AAH). This situation plunges patients into medical wandering. Thus, he asks the Government if it intends to recognize AVF as a long-term condition.
